Historic petition to end unpaid work for flight attendants lands

$ 27.50 · 4.9 (346) · In stock

An historic petition has landed in the House of Commons, calling on the federal government to fix loopholes that allow airlines to require flight attendants to work an average of 35 hours every month for free.
